Overview:

We are seeking a seasoned Technical Manager to lead the design and development of our next-generation Intelligent Lighting Systems. In this role, you will lead cross-disciplinary teams to deliver new systems, products and features overseeing the seamless integration of sensing technologies, wireless protocols, and cloud-connected control software to deliver lighting solutions that are responsive, energy-efficient, and secure. We believe strongly that our products need to be more than just connected but provide precise, reliable, and responsive performance in real-world environments at scale.  

Responsibilities:
  • Engineering Leadership & Execution: Manage a cross-functional team of embedded firmware, software, and systems engineers to deliver high-performance intelligent lighting solutions. 
  • Technical Leadership: Direct the end-to-end development of cyber-physical systems, ensuring hardware and software components are optimized for performance and reliability. 
  • Team Mentorship: Lead and grow a team of engineers fostering a culture of technical excellence and customer-centricity and quality. 
  • Strategic Vision: Stay ahead of industry trends in IoT, smart building standards and relevant technologies to ensure our intelligent lighting products remain market leading. 
Qualifications:
  • EducationBach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or a related technical field. Master’s degree preferred.  Minimum, cumulative GPA of 3.00 for all degrees earned
  • Experience: Minimum of 10 years in the development of customer-facing software systems, with a proven track record of shipping hardware-software integrated products. Minimum of 2 years in a leadership position.
  • Leadership: Prior experience managing engineering teams, with the ability to balance technical debt, innovation, and strict hardware release deadlines. 
  • Technical Literacy: Strong understanding of software development methodologies and relevant development technologies.
